I have a question about the lasso tool and I wonder if maybe you can help me. Whenever I use the lasso tool it leaves a residue of the first color used just slightly outside the edges of the selection. Even if I erase the content it will leave that line behind. Have you come across the same problem? And if so, how have you fixed it? Thank you in advanced.
@PixelPusher
@PixelPusher 4 года назад
Hey Samarcanda, Thank you. Im glad they are useful :) Yeah so at the top of photoshop (beneath all the tabs, file, edit ect.) when you have lasso selected you should see feather. I imagine you have that on. It should be set to 0px. Also, turn on Anti - alias if its not already (should be to the right of feather). Hope that helps, if not im not sure what it is thats causing the problem. Also make sure your working with a high enough resolution. Around the 2000 mark or above with 200dpi should be fine.
